CARY, N.C. -- The fourth annual USA Baseball National High School Invitational and the inaugural International Prospect Series begin play at the USA Baseball National Training Complex next week, bringing top U.S. high school players and July 2, 2015 free agent eligible international prospect together in one location for the first time. The National High School Invitational single-elimination championship tournament runs Wednesday, March 25 to Saturday, March 28, while the International Prospect Series takes the field for games on Friday, March 27 and Saturday, March 28.

The 2015 National High School Invitational features eight programs currently ranked in the Baseball America top-25, highlighted by the nation's No. 1 ranked team, College Park High School in Pleasant Hill, Calif. Joining the Falcons in the top-10 are No. 5 College Station HS (College Station, Texas), No. 7 JSerra Catholic High School (San Juan Capistrano, Calif.) and No. 8 Mosley High School (Lynn Haven, Fla.).

The International Prospect Series is a two day event, March 27 and 28, which includes games between the International All-Star Prospects and two local North Carolina high schools, South Caldwell High School and Providence High School.

INTERNATIONAL PROSPECT SERIES

Event Information: Announced in February by Major League Baseball and USA Baseball, the International Prospect Series features players from Aruba, Colombia, Curacao, Dominican Republic, Nicaragua, Panama and Venezuela against South Caldwell High School and Providence High School.

"Major League Baseball is proud to stand alongside USA Baseball on the launch of the International Prospect Series," said Baseball Commissioner Robert D. Manfred, Jr. "In the years ahead, our global game will aim to develop more players -- at all levels and from all communities. This event promises to be a strong showcase of amateur talent in a format that can help advance the careers of many players."
